Output d91a14bef6ea9d3334275a50ca3aa6492e61c2a89bd54486483000640b99a711:1

value
10393651
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8059acd4dc5090bcc9347afe0d81ffed530955e OP_EQUALVERIFY OP_CHECKSIG
address
1KEcrnev1GmKLCYeTvr1SXg7bVyHrPyi4H
transaction
d91a14bef6ea9d3334275a50ca3aa6492e61c2a89bd54486483000640b99a711
confirmations
303273
spent
true